Over 68% of globally shipped modular smart hubs (2023–2024) trace back to Shenzhen and Dongguan OEM/ODM facilities—per Statista’s IoT Hardware Sourcing Report. What makes these devices stand out? Not just cost, but real-world interoperability, rapid firmware iteration, and certified Matter 1.3 readiness.

Take modularity: unlike monolithic systems, Guangdong’s latest generation lets users snap in Zigbee 3.0 sensors, Thread radios, or even LoRaWAN gateways—all on one base unit. We tested 12 units across 3 tiers (budget, mid, premium) for latency, OTA update success rate, and local processing capability:

Feature Budget Tier (e.g., Mijia Clone) Mid-Tier (e.g., Tuya Pro Series) Premium Tier (e.g., Aqara M3+)
Avg. OTA Success Rate (%) 82.3 95.7 99.1
Local Processing Latency (ms) 186 43 12
Matter Certification Status Not certified Provisional (v1.2) Full v1.3 (UL 2900-2-2 validated)

Here’s what matters most: certification isn’t paperwork—it’s trust. UL 2900-2-2 validation means rigorous cybersecurity testing: no default passwords, encrypted firmware signing, and secure boot enforced. Only 14% of budget-tier units passed even basic penetration tests (source: AV-TEST Institute, Q1 2024).

And yes—lead times are shrinking. Average production-to-shipment is now 16.2 days for MOQ ≥500 units (down from 28.7 days in 2022), thanks to Guangdong’s integrated PCB, casing, and firmware assembly lines.

If you're evaluating suppliers, don’t stop at Alibaba listings. Ask for: (1) UL or CSA test reports, (2) Matter certification logs—not just logos—and (3) evidence of over-the-air rollback capability (a critical fail-safe).
